Wiktionary

Wiktionary is a project in the form of a wiki to develop an online dictionary so that English-speakers can look up the meanings for words in any of the languages which Wiktionary supports (which is most of them). Wiktionary is also a thesaurus, so you can compare meanings within a language. Wiktionary is run by the Wikimedia Foundation, which also runs Wikipedia and other projects. The English Wiktionary currently has pages for over 7.1 million words and phrases, and 3.9 million users. Right now you are reading Wiktionary in Simple English, but like the other Wikimedia projects, the dictionary and thesaurus has projects run by speakers of several different languages; which language you are looking at can be selected from the main page.
